The chilly water of Northern California churns off the rocky coast of Mendocino, a picturesque seaside town with a population of under 900. Trails run along the cliffs, providing an incredible view of the pounding surf below. Between waves, the crystal clear water provides a magical view into the kelp forest that grows from the sea floor.
